#d44130 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d44130 is composed of 83.1% red, 25.5%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 69.3% magenta, 77.4%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 6.2 degrees, a saturation of 65.6% and a lightness of 51%. #d44130 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ff8260 with #a90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

#d44130 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d44130 has RGB values of R:212, G:65,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.69, Y:0.77,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13910320.

Shades and Tints of #d44130
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040101 is the darkest color, while #fcf4f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d44130
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#877e7d is the less saturated color, while #fa230a is the most saturated one.
